Figma
What is Figma?
Figma is a cloud-based design and prototyping platform that has transformed how teams create digital products. Founded in 2012 by Dylan Field and Evan Wallace, Figma was the first professional design tool built entirely for the browser, eliminating traditional barriers of file management, software installation, and platform compatibility. With its acquisition by Adobe in 2022, Figma continues to operate independently while serving millions of designers, developers, and product teams worldwide.
What sets Figma apart from traditional design tools is its real-time collaboration capability—multiple designers can work simultaneously on the same file, seeing each other’s cursors and changes instantly. This collaborative approach, combined with powerful design features, responsive auto-layout, component systems, and interactive prototyping, has made Figma the industry standard for UI/UX design. From startups to enterprises like Microsoft, Uber, and Airbnb, Figma powers the design systems that shape modern digital experiences.
Key Features
- Real-Time Collaboration: Multiple designers work simultaneously on the same file with live cursors, comments, and instant sync
- Auto Layout: Create responsive designs that automatically resize and reflow based on content changes
- Components and Variants: Build reusable design elements with multiple states and properties
- Interactive Prototyping: Create clickable prototypes with transitions, animations, and smart animate
- Design Systems: Establish consistent libraries of components, styles, and patterns shared across projects
- FigJam: Collaborative whiteboarding for brainstorming, planning, and workshops
- Developer Handoff: Developers inspect designs, copy CSS/code, and export assets directly
- Plugins Ecosystem: Thousands of community plugins extend functionality
- Branching: Create design branches to explore alternatives without affecting the main file
- Version History: Access complete history of changes with ability to restore previous versions
What’s New in Figma 2025
- AI-Powered Features: First Draft generates layouts from descriptions, Make Designs suggests design improvements
- Dev Mode: Enhanced developer experience with code generation, ready-for-dev status, and VS Code extension
- Variables: Create design tokens for colors, spacing, and more that automatically update across designs
- Advanced Prototyping: Variables in prototypes enable dynamic, data-driven interactions
- Figma Slides: Create presentations directly in Figma with design-first approach
- Multi-Edit: Select and edit multiple components simultaneously across frames
- Improved Performance: Faster loading, smoother scrolling, and better handling of large files
- Native Desktop Features: Enhanced desktop app with system-level integrations
System Requirements
Web Browser (Primary)
- Browsers: Chrome 90+, Firefox 95+, Safari 15+, Edge 90+ (Chrome recommended)
- RAM: 4 GB minimum (8 GB+ recommended for large files)
- Graphics: WebGL-capable graphics card
- Internet: Stable broadband connection
Desktop App (Windows)
- Operating System: Windows 10 64-bit or later
- Processor: Intel Core i3 or equivalent
- RAM: 4 GB minimum (8 GB recommended)
- Storage: 500 MB for application
Desktop App (macOS)
- Operating System: macOS 10.15 Catalina or later
- Processor: Intel or Apple Silicon (native M1/M2/M3 support)
- RAM: 4 GB minimum (8 GB recommended)
- Storage: 500 MB for application
How to Install Figma
- Create Account: Visit figma.com and sign up with email, Google, or SSO. Free tier includes 3 Figma files and unlimited personal files.
- Use Web Version: Figma works entirely in browser—simply navigate to figma.com and start designing. No installation required for full functionality.
- Download Desktop App (Optional): Visit figma.com/downloads for Windows and macOS desktop apps. Desktop apps offer benefits like better font access, offline viewing, and system shortcuts.
- Install Desktop App (Windows): Run the downloaded FigmaSetup.exe installer. The app installs to your user folder and syncs with your Figma account automatically.
- Install Desktop App (macOS): Open the downloaded Figma.dmg and drag to Applications. The desktop app is optimized for Apple Silicon Macs.
- Configure Workspace: Set up your workspace by:
# Essential first steps: # 1. Install plugins: Resources > Plugins # 2. Enable font access (desktop app) # 3. Create your first project # 4. Explore starter templates # Recommended plugins: # - Figma to Code (for developers) # - Iconify (icon library) # - Unsplash (stock photos) # - Content Reel (placeholder content) # - Stark (accessibility checking)
Pros and Cons
Pros
- Real-time collaboration eliminates version conflicts and merge issues
- Browser-based access works on any operating system without installation
- Generous free tier sufficient for individuals and small teams
- Auto Layout creates truly responsive, flexible designs
- Component variants reduce file clutter while maintaining flexibility
- Developer handoff features streamline design-to-code workflow
- Extensive plugin ecosystem extends core functionality
- Regular updates deliver new features without software updates
- FigJam integration enables seamless ideation-to-design workflow
- Industry-leading performance for browser-based tool
Cons
- Requires internet connection for core functionality (limited offline viewing)
- Complex files can strain browser performance
- Learning curve for advanced features like variables and branching
- Limited illustration tools compared to Adobe Illustrator
- Professional features require paid subscription
- Font availability depends on installed fonts or Figma font library
Figma vs Alternatives
| Feature | Figma | Sketch | Adobe XD | Framer |
|---|---|---|---|---|
| Price | Free / $15/mo | $12/mo | $9.99/mo | Free / $20/mo |
| Platform | Web + Desktop | macOS Only | Win + Mac | Web + Desktop |
| Real-Time Collab | Excellent | Limited | Good | Excellent |
| Auto Layout | Excellent | Good | Basic | Excellent |
| Prototyping | Excellent | Basic | Good | Advanced |
| Developer Handoff | Excellent | Good | Good | Excellent |
| Plugins | Extensive | Extensive | Limited | Growing |
| Learning Curve | Moderate | Moderate | Easy | Moderate |
Who Should Use Figma?
Figma is ideal for design professionals and teams who value collaboration and modern workflows:
- UI/UX Designers: Industry-standard tool for interface design with powerful layout and component features
- Product Teams: Real-time collaboration enables designers, developers, and stakeholders to work together seamlessly
- Design System Teams: Build and maintain scalable design systems with components, variables, and libraries
- Remote Teams: Browser-based access and real-time sync perfect for distributed teams
- Developers: Dev Mode provides specifications, code snippets, and assets without designer intervention
- Students: Free education accounts and gentle learning curve make it ideal for learning design
Consider alternatives if: You’re a Mac-exclusive shop preferring native macOS integration (Sketch), you need advanced illustration capabilities (Adobe Illustrator), or you want code-based responsive design output (Framer, Webflow).
Frequently Asked Questions
Is Figma free to use?
Yes, Figma offers a generous Starter plan that includes 3 Figma files, unlimited personal drafts, unlimited collaborators for viewing, and access to most features. Professional plans ($15/editor/month) add unlimited files, team libraries, and advanced features.
Does Figma work offline?
The desktop app allows viewing recently accessed files offline, but editing and syncing require an internet connection. Figma’s cloud-based architecture means full functionality depends on connectivity.
Can I use Figma without the desktop app?
Yes, Figma works fully in web browsers without any installation. The desktop app is optional and primarily offers better font access, offline viewing, and some system-level integrations.
How does Figma compare to Adobe XD?
Figma generally offers superior real-time collaboration, more powerful auto-layout features, and works across all platforms. Adobe has de-prioritized XD development, making Figma the safer long-term choice for new projects.
Is Figma good for beginners?
Yes, Figma’s intuitive interface and free access make it excellent for beginners. The learning curve is manageable, and extensive documentation, YouTube tutorials, and community resources support learning.
Final Verdict
Figma has earned its position as the industry-leading design tool by prioritizing collaboration, accessibility, and continuous innovation. The browser-first approach eliminates traditional software barriers while delivering professional-grade capabilities that rival or exceed desktop-only alternatives. Real-time collaboration transforms how teams work together, while features like Auto Layout, Components, and Variables provide the power to create sophisticated, scalable design systems.
Whether you’re a solo designer, part of a product team, or managing enterprise design systems, Figma provides the tools to bring digital products from concept to developer handoff efficiently. The generous free tier, platform independence, and robust feature set make it the natural choice for modern design workflows.
Download Options
Safe & Secure
Verified and scanned for viruses
Regular Updates
Always get the latest version
24/7 Support
Help available when you need it